Elsie's Meringue Rice Pudding Recipe

Ingredients:

1 c rice
Rice Pudding:
1 quart milk
1 c sugar
3 tbsp cornstarch
3 whole eggs
3 egg yolks
1 tsp vanilla

Meringue:
3 egg whites
1/4 tsp cream of tartar
6 tbsp sugar
1/8 tsp salt
1/4 tsp vanilla

Directions:
Directions:
Pudding: Cook 1 cup of rice until done. Add milk, let come to a boil and cook 5 minutes. Stir so it won't burn (a heavy kettle helps). Remove from heat. Mix together with hand mixer sugar, cornstarch, whole eggs, egg yolks, and 1 vanilla; Add to rice and milk mixture and cook gently until thickened. Pour into casserole dish.

Meringue: Combine egg whites with cream of tartar. Beat until soft peaks form. Beat in gradually sugar, salt and vanilla. Top casserole with meringue and bake 15 minutes at 350º or until meringue is slightly browned.
